AI Summary

  • Exempts retail sales of school supplies priced under $50 from sales tax during a period beginning at 12:01 a.m. on the last Friday in July and ending at 12:00 midnight the following Saturday.

  • Defines "school supplies" as 41 specific items commonly used by students in coursework, including backpacks, binders, calculators, pencils, pens, notebooks, paper, markers, paints, folders, and textbooks.

  • Allows municipalities to suspend the exemption within their corporate limits by adopting a resolution and notifying the Department of Revenue at least 90 days before the suspension takes effect (effective January 1, 2019).

  • Maintains all existing sales tax claims, assessments, appeals, and collection proceedings that accrued before July 1, 2018.

  • Takes effect July 1, 2018.

Legislative Description

Sales tax; exempt retail sales of school supplies during the last weekend in July.
